Guadalupe County Sheriff's Auto Theft Unit Makes Major Arrests in Stolen Equipment Cases


GUADALUPE COUNTY, TX — This week, the Guadalupe County Sheriff’s Office Auto Theft Unit closed two major stolen property investigations involving skid steers and trailers.

The first case, initiated in February 2025, involved multiple reports of stolen skid steers in the Marion and Cibolo areas. Investigators identified and arrested Nicholas Beintema in connection with these thefts.

The second investigation began in June 2025 after reports of stolen trailers from various storage facilities across the county. Undercover officers arranged a sting operation in Comal County, where Kendarious Goodlow was caught attempting to sell a stolen trailer. With help from the Comal County Sheriff’s Office and New Braunfels Police Department, Goodlow was arrested and returned to Guadalupe County.

During interviews, Goodlow was linked to multiple other trailer thefts across Guadalupe County and nearby areas. Authorities believe additional trailer thefts may have gone unreported.
